Abstract (EN)
Is philosophy a language mistake? Does the language ever go on holiday? This dissertation explores these questions by adapting the concept of "The Law of Leaky Abstractions" from computer science, where it holds that all non-trivial abstractions are leaky to some degree, and extending it to the domain of philosophy. It argues that language, morality, systems, and theoretical frameworks are themselves leaky abstractions that obscure as much as they reveal. Drawing on the genealogical critique of Nietzsche and the philosophy of Wittgenstein, the project reinterprets problems such as the limits of language, the illusion of essential truths, and the bewitchment and seduction by means of language. It further applies this perspective to contemporary issues such as political correctness and the pursuit of a unified theory in physics. By framing philosophical and cultural systems as abstractions prone to leakage, the dissertation examines whether our abstraction capacity ever truly escapes its own illusions.
